Transaction 53e5982086184884e541a3496b1d968da8ce400bb23d686bfd27b01847ea1723
1 Input
1 Output
-
53e5982086184884e541a3496b1d968da8ce400bb23d686bfd27b01847ea1723:0
- value
- 605000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5e7ca51adff256f49735e337d69cdcaa0b9e7c988de5187718e2e6b125d6fe0b
- address
- bc1pte722xkl7ft0f9e4uvmad8xu4g9eulyc3hj3saccutntzfwklc9sdt5aqh